Transaction 42a59e70c33276da7df935f41b48b541c113d3117fe021c44cb6c701c515b546
1 Input
2 Outputs
- 42a59e70c33276da7df935f41b48b541c113d3117fe021c44cb6c701c515b546:0
- 42a59e70c33276da7df935f41b48b541c113d3117fe021c44cb6c701c515b546:1
value 9400000
address 1592kX26nV9RPFniyUFkemNQeKqdU34C3r
value 133315520
address 1PAj6LCyNk4e3ce8ztBfTWJ9ij6StRBVwu